Celebrating its 25th anniversary, Wikipedia stands at a crossroads, facing technological shifts that are redefining how people seek information online. The site, famous for its vast and multilingual crowdsourced database, has watched new competitors and changing user habits impact its reach. Recent trends reveal that reliance on Wikipedia as a direct resource is waning as automated technologies deliver knowledge in new ways. This transition tests Wikipedia’s commitment to open access while it explores new strategies to retain contributors, audiences, and financial support. The outcome may determine how millions continue to learn and share information globally.

While concerns about Wikipedia’s future have surfaced before, earlier reports focused more on vandalism, content reliability, and the challenge of keeping articles updated. At those times, traffic remained high, and the threat was mainly about ensuring accurate information and sufficient volunteer editors. Now, falling page views coincide with the widespread use of large language models like ChatGPT, which aggregate Wikipedia’s data without funneling visitors back to the site. Compared to previous challenges, this shift raises questions about Wikipedia’s visibility and influence in a rapidly evolving content ecosystem dominated by artificial intelligence and new media platforms.

How Is Wikipedia Responding to Automated Knowledge Tools?

An 8 percent decline in human traffic highlights the pressure Wikipedia faces from A.I.-driven search engines and chatbots. Users seeking answers increasingly turn to these automated services, which often extract information from Wikipedia without generating direct site traffic. Senior product leaders suggest that the overall dissemination of Wikipedia’s content may, paradoxically, be greater than ever, even as fewer people visit the original platform. Marshall Miller, senior director of product at the Wikimedia Foundation, noted,

“Yes, there is a decline in traffic to our sites, but there may well be more people getting Wikipedia knowledge than ever because of how much it’s being distributed through those platforms that are upstream of us.”

How Is Wikipedia Securing Its Future Revenue and Contributors?

Wikipedia’s main revenue comes from individual donations as well as agreements with tech companies accessing its content at scale. With Wikimedia Enterprise, partners such as Microsoft, Google, Amazon, Perplexity AI, and Mistral AI now pay to utilize Wikipedia’s data in their services. This move helps balance the financial challenge posed by reduced direct web visits. However, there is a concern that a decline in page views could eventually shrink Wikipedia’s pool of volunteer editors, which is crucial for maintaining its content base and editorial standards.

What New Approaches Is Wikipedia Taking to Connect With Younger Audiences?

To adapt to changing user habits, Wikipedia is refining mobile tools and experimenting with content for platforms popular with younger audiences, including YouTube and TikTok. Features like Edit Check and Tone Check use A.I. to guide volunteers, while efforts to increase transparency might display more metadata in responses presented by third-party chatbots. The debate within the community over the use of A.I. for article creation reflects the complexity of integrating new technologies while maintaining trust and neutrality. Wikipedia is also working to ensure that A.I.-driven platforms credit the original source, aiming to renew awareness and interest in collaborative editing.

The wider adoption of “pay-to-crawl” models across media organizations mirrors Wikipedia’s efforts to ensure both sustainability and fair compensation when its data is scraped for A.I. use. As other outlets strike content licensing deals with A.I. companies, Wikipedia’s approach may help keep it relevant in the digital content supply chain. Lane Becker, senior director of earned revenue at the Wikimedia Foundation, reflected this strategic shift, stating,

“There’s a growing understanding on the part of these A.I. companies about the significance of the Wikipedia dataset, both as it currently exists and also its need to exist in the future.”
